Autonomous Navigation Engines

Our navigation stacks fuse data from GPS, IMUs, LIDAR, and computer vision to guide unmanned vehicles with minimal human input. The result is real-time pathfinding, obstacle avoidance, and adaptive rerouting—even in denied or low-signal environments.

Whether mapping terrain, conducting search-and-rescue, or patrolling borders, our software ensures consistent, self-directed movement with dynamic response to changing conditions.
